fortnite frog location
Frogs can be found all over the Fortnite map, but they are found in areas with water, most often along river banks.
Rivers leading away from the Citadel are a reliable place to look, but as long as you’re looking along river banks, you shouldn’t have any trouble finding one.
How to hunt frogs that are five meters or less in fortnite
frogs get in very quickly Fortnite So once you’ve found it, you’ll need to run right up to it and hip-fire your weapon while running before it can get away. Alternatively, if you’re a quick maker, you can box the frog to make sure it can’t escape.
Hunting a frog from less than five meters away will complete the weekly quest, awarding a cool 16,000 XP to unlock Super Level Styles.
